Marcia Burtt plein air painting at Goleta Beach. I attended Marcia's January 2011 plein air painting workshop in Santa Barbara California. Here is her website: http://www.marciaburtt.com/ Marcia's workshop was excellent. She demonstrated her clear colorful painting style every morning and then she personally helped each of us as we painted all day long. We worked from 8:30 am to 5pm every day. Except for Tuesday when we stayed till 6:30pm to paint the rising full moon. Brooks plein air painting at Goleta Beach California. Here are a few of my paintings from Santa Barbara. Oregon Society of Artists January 2011 Show

Image
"Sunny Portland", "Congregational Church", and "Benson House" are all in the Oregon Society of Artists show "60+ the New 40s". This show will be on display January 9, 2011 through January 31, 2011, at 2185 SW Park Place, Portland Oregon. The OSA gallery is open 1-4pm Tuesday - Saturday. "Sunny Portland" image is 15x22 inches acrylic. "Congregational Church" image is 22x15 inches acrylic. Benson House image is 15x22 inches - acrylic.
